Q: Is 967,445 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 967,445 is not a prime number.

Why is 967,445 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 967445 can be evenly divided by 1 5 181 905 1,069 5,345 193,489 and 967,445, with no remainder.

Since 967,445 cannot be divided by just 1 and 967,445, it is not a prime number.
